WebJul 25, 2024 · Diverticulosis is defined by the presence of sac-like herniation of the colonic mucosa through the muscularis mucosa at sites of vascular weakness (Image 1) [].Diverticular disease of the colon is the most common incidental lesion found on routine colonoscopy [].It is ranked in the top 10 leading diagnoses in the outpatient setting and … WebIntroduction. Diverticulosis coli is defined as the presence of sac-like protrusions in the colonic wall [].Over half of adults older than 70 years of age undergoing colonoscopy are noted to have incidental diverticulosis [].Manifestations and complications of diverticular disease include acute diverticulitis, symptomatic uncomplicated diverticular disease … WebDiverticular disease and anxiety disorders are common in the general population. WebOnce symptoms develop, the term ‘diverticular disease’ is used, and the inflammation that gives rise to symptoms is known as ‘diverticulitis’ (see Figure). Figure 1: Diverticulosis and diverticulitis. Diverticulosis occurs when pouches (diverticula) develop in the wall of the colon. Diverticulitis is when these pouches become inflamed ...

WebFeb 11, 2015 · Diverticulosis and diverticulitis. Diverticula are pouch-like structures that form in the wall of the large intestine.
